Title: 1308cc 9:1 with K03?
Post by: Max on June 04, 2009, 06:39:03 pm
Chaps, my engine needs a full bottom end rebuild and the head could well be cracked...

I can get hold of a 1308cc engine, with cast oversized pistons, freshly rebuilt bottom end, but the comp ratio is 9:1.

It also comes with a gas flowed head.

Would I have any issues running a K03 (digifant management) with 9:1?  Power wise I only want about 170-180bhp.

Post by: jez1272gt on June 09, 2009, 12:57:52 pm
1341 will mean a more reliable/stronger bottom end as you will have forged pistons and, if you are sensible, you will replace all bearing shells, nuts/bolts/gaskets and pumps etc so you know its as healthy as ever!

Only you can really judge whether its worth it financially or not, as its not cheap to do though. Also do your research into what pistons you want to use! There is a fair bit on here if you use the search function!

Post by: hardchargin40 on July 30, 2009, 02:08:05 am
Is the 1308cc my old engine?  If so, Race Power Motorsport built it.  Was built to rev to 8500 cleanly, karl-schmitt pistons, 9:1 comp. ecu chip limited to 8k at time.  Though needs a change of camshaft to take advantage of the revs, as it only made peak ps at 6600rpm, cam was wrong spec.  Found that out at end, could never get setup and working properly (cam, vernier, charger blowing seal springs constantly, alternator goosed, then piston rings (only lasted a few k miles, etc), as we wanted a peak ps at 8000 - 8200rpm .  I had it rebuilt with stock rings after using a g-lader to use a gt25 turbo with jenvey iTB's and dta management but sold it to fund my house.
